Imagine possessing the power to make anyone you have a crush on, fall madly in love with you or the power to ensure your spouse never cheats or asks for a divorce.
Though it may sound humanly impossible, a man at the Kwame Nkrumah Circle in Accra is claiming to possess such powers.
He sells love potions to customers who are more than willing to part with some cash to get the love of their lives.
Inside the shop are bottles containing herbs and spices, some tied with a red cloth.
To make the love potion, Inusah tells Joy News’ Fostina Sarfo all he requires is a few strands of hair, fingernails and pubic hair.

These items are burnt and then used to make cologne which must be used whenever the lady visits her lover; the potion once inhaled keeps the partner glued to her so much so that, he would never take a second look at another woman.
Inusah claims even if a marriage is on the verge of collapsing, he can prevent either party from getting a divorce.
“If you discover that your husband or wife is cheating, or probably you may have parted ways for two to three years, I can assure you my potion is potent enough to bring him/her back into your arms,” he stated.
It gets interesting Inusah says if you have been in a relationship for years and yet your partner shows no interest in walking you down the aisle, he has a potion that would make them do so in less than a week.

Whilst interacting with Inusah we had to cut filming multiple times, customers kept trooping in for various reasons, most of whom declined to speak on camera. But off-camera a young man said Inusah helped him boost his sexual performance which saved his marriage.
Would you go as far as getting a love potion to draw the one you love?
“Never, even if single I won’t go for a potion to get a guy. There are too many fishes in the ocean to try charming just one,” one lady said.
Another guy, said “if you feel she is the right one for you, why not, I will consider it, sometimes a man has to do what a man has to do to get what he wants.”
True love comes naturally but if Inusah’s potion is anything to go by, then love can be evoked or better still, bought. Either way, let love lead.
